The quote “Change is inevitable, change will always happen, but you have to apply direction to change, and that's when it's progress” by Doug Baldwin draws a clear distinction between change and progress. Baldwin emphasizes that while change is a natural and unavoidable part of life—constantly happening around and within us—it doesn’t automatically lead to improvement or growth. True progress requires intentionality, meaning we must consciously guide change toward a specific, positive outcome.

Doug Baldwin, a former NFL wide receiver known not only for his athletic talent but also for his leadership and social activism, often speaks about personal development and community empowerment. This quote likely stems from his experience both on the field and off, where adapting to change is essential, but only leads to success when paired with purpose and focus. Baldwin’s words reflect a mindset rooted in strategic thinking and goal-setting.

The idea that “you have to apply direction to change” suggests that without a clear vision, change can be chaotic or even harmful. Whether in personal growth, societal movements, or professional environments, it's not enough to embrace change passively—we must steer it. That deliberate direction is what transforms random shifts into meaningful progress.

Ultimately, Baldwin’s quote serves as both a motivational reminder and a strategic insight. It encourages individuals and leaders alike to take responsibility for shaping the change they experience, turning it into a force for good. In doing so, we not only adapt to a changing world—we help shape it into something better.
